The Baker Center for Children and Families (also known as Judge Baker Children's Center), promotes the best possible mental health of children and families through the integration of research, intervention, training, and policy.
The Individual Support Team (IST) Behavioral Services Coordinator is a managerial position within the Behavioral Services Department responsible for consistent application of evidence-based behavioral practices and the supervision of Milieu Counselors for the Manville School. The primary focus of the IST Behavioral Services Coordinator is to oversee the implementation of advanced tiers of support for students in need of specialized behavioral interventions. The IST Behavioral Services Coordinator collaborates with the Universal Support Team (UST) Behavioral Services Coordinator and the Board-Certified Behavioral Analyst (BCBA) to develop and implement small group interventions and behavior support plans designed to strengthen students' school readiness skills. This individual will also provide modeling, coaching, training, and direct crisis management for the Manville School.

Essential duties:
  • Monitors the entry of behavioral data and completion of incident reports and physical management reports to ensure timeliness and accuracy.
  • Oversees/facilitates communication in a timely manner with caregivers regarding significant behavioral events (e.g., physical restraint, suspension, etc.).
  • Provides management and leadership of behavioral services in Manville School, in collaboration with UST Behavioral Services Coordinator.
  • Facilitates training and coaching opportunities with classroom teams utilizing a Behavioral Skills Training model.
  • Supervises Milieu Counselors and the Board-Certified Behavioral Analyst (BCBA).
  • Ensures the Manville School is adhering to Positive Behavioral Interventions and Supports (PBIS) framework.
  • Oversees the referral process for BCBA support, related assessments, and behavior support plans.
  • Supervises the Assessment classroom team in conjunction with other members of the Individual Support Team.
  • Supports the daily operations of the Manville School in collaboration with the Assistant Principal and other managers.
  • Attends and actively participates in managerial/administrative meetings.
  • Attends/Co-facilitates all mandatory trainings (e.g., CPI, PBIS, OT, etc.).
  • Attends quarterly student progress meetings to facilitate behavioral updates.
  • Attends regular supervision with Assistant Principal and/or Director of Behavioral Services and incorporates their feedback effectively into day-to-day work.
